    Already said this but events held abroad tend to lose coverage from sports media in the US. Also, holding a fight in a major city can get people talking about that fight in that city or state, which in turn creates more buzz. Media are also less likely to fork out the money to send their staff abroad to cover the fight, which again leads to less coverage.
